By two and a half, many toddlers can use more than 350 words and pronounce words with two or more syllables, like \u201cbanana\u201d and \u201cplayground.\u201d They get the concepts of size (big versus little) and quantity (a bit, more, a lot). Remembering and understanding familiar stories\u2014like the one about the train you\u2019ve read a zillion times\u2014as well as familiar signs and logos, such as a stop sign or a store you visit regularly, is another toddler skill at this age. Showing concern when another child is sad or hurt is also <strong>part of toddler development<\/strong>. When they\u2019re playing, they begin to put several actions together, like putting play food in the wagon, pulling the wagon to the \u201crestaurant\u201d and handing the food to the chef. When it comes to physical skills, most kids who are two and a half can walk up stairs using one foot for each stair, kick a ball, jump with both feet, run without falling and draw a line if you show them how. If they\u2014or you\u2014aren\u2019t ready for a big-kid bed, you can try a few tricks: If the crib has a lower side, turn that side against the wall, put your toddler in a sleep sack and keep the mattress on the lowest setting. Still, a determined toddler who is intent on busting out of crib jail will find a way, so if it\u2019s time to switch to a bed, make sure to childproof their whole room and gate the bedroom door or stairs.<\/p>\n<h3><strong>Encouraging solo play<br \/><\/strong><\/h3>\n<p>While you have spent a <em>lot<\/em> of time on the floor, on the couch and in the park playing with your toddler over the past eight months, you\u2019ve probably also noticed stretches of time where they are <strong>playing on their own<\/strong> (whew, a few quiet or not-so-quiet moments to yourself!). This is typical toddler behaviour, too, as they explore the world and then head back to the safe security of your arms. Wanting to be picked up is often a sign of seeking comfort during a transition, like adjusting to a big-kid bed rather than a crib, as well as needing a snuggle when they\u2019re tired or <strong>getting over a bug<\/strong>. And sometimes your little guy just wants a better view! You won\u2019t spoil them by picking them up when they ask. And if you don\u2019t carry them when they want you to, that\u2019s OK, too\u2014ask them to be your helper by carrying something, count the stairs together as you walk up or crouch down for a 30-second cuddle.<\/p>\n<h3><strong>Taming the tantrums<br \/><\/strong><\/h3>\n<p>Studies report that 60 to 90 percent of two-year-olds have tantrums (and for the 10 to 40 percent who apparently don\u2019t, we say, really?!). Their frequency peaks at 30 to 36 months, when flipping out may happen daily. <strong>Tantrums are usually triggered by frustration<\/strong>, and when you look at the world from a toddler POV, you can see how things are just <em>so<\/em> not fair. Even though meltdowns are a normal part of development, you can still help your toddler cope\u2014and head off your own breakdown, too. Keep an eye out for triggers: Is your toddler tired, hungry, thirsty or hot? Are you distracted? Is the day too rushed? Is there something fun but unusual going on, like a party? Those are all <strong>classic set-ups for a tantrum<\/strong>.<\/p>\n<p>When a tantrum does happen, your response should be simple: Stay calm, and don\u2019t try to reason with your kid\u2014they simply can\u2019t hear you when they\u2019re in full meltdown mode. If the tantrum is about demanding some neon sugar cereal <strong>at the grocery store<\/strong>, just remove yourselves from the situation and ignore the request and the tantrum until they settle down. Some ideas for your toolkit: Be clear on consequences (\u201cCrayons are for paper, so if you draw on the wall again, we put the art away\u201d), model the behaviour (\u201cI put one block in the bin and then you put one block in the bin\u201d), name the feelings (\u201cI can see you\u2019re upset that Avery took the blue Play-Doh. Do you want to go to the couch with me and calm down?\u201d) and redirect them (\u201cI\u2019m not buying those shoes, but can you help me pick out the socks we need?\u201d).<\/p>\n<h2><strong>Your life after baby<\/strong><\/h2>\n<h3><strong>Still considering <\/strong><strong>baby number 2<\/strong><strong>?<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/www.todaysparent.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2018\/03\/was-i-selfish-for-putting-off-another-baby-768x432-1521472973.jpg\" alt=\"Father and son shoes.\"><br \/>\n<span>Was I selfish for putting off another baby?<\/span><br \/>\nMaybe it\u2019s been on your mind lately. Other reasons could be that they\u2019re ready to shorten their afternoon nap, it\u2019s time to change their bedtime or they\u2019re just wired to be early birds. One thing to try (unless, of course, you like starting your day at 5 a.m.) is a <strong>special toddler clock<\/strong> with a light that comes on at a preset time or sun and moon symbols to help your toddler understand if it\u2019s an OK time to get up. The goal is to gradually get them to stay in bed longer in the mornings, even if they\u2019re not actually asleep.
